I rebuilt the engine last year new bearing etc, on the left hand side ( when sat on it) there is a ticking noise I thought it was tappit clearance so reset them several times without impact has anyone got some suggestions what to look for during these dark winter months. I am thinking a bent valve or worn guide bush ?

I had the same tappetty noise not long after a rebuild.  After taking the rocker cover off to investigate, it turned out to be the tacho gearing on the camshaft was cracked.  The cam that's in now has worn lobes but it's quieter.   If anyone knows someone who can repair the cracked gear on the cam, please let me know.

As slight blow from the exhaust to head gasket sounds just like a loose tappet

Have you removed all the tappets and checked that none are chipped ? Also check oil feed to that side of the head, had a twin in once that had tappet noise on the side stand but, it was fine on the centre stand.

The head is now off and stripped down, the inlet valve on the noisy side is bent slightly so im thinking that wont help.
next the head is not flat, so needs skimming, anyone know somewhere that does this in west yorkshire?
